Special Schools and Education Centres
Special schools provide education for students with disabilities. Different programs are available in regular schools to support students with disabilities. This support may be provided either in mainstream classes or in special classes. An education unit at The Canberra Hospital assists students who are confined to hospital for long periods.
Provision is made within schools to cater for the needs of children with special skills and abilities as well as for children with learning or behavioural difficulties.
